SUPERIOR FEDERAL BANK v. MACKEY

No. CA 02-1119.

129 S.W.3d 324 (2003)

SUPERIOR FEDERAL BANK v. George MACKEY and Jones & Mackey Construction Company, LLC.

Court of Appeals of Arkansas, Division IV.

November 19, 2003.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Mitchell, Williams, Selig, Gates & Woodyard, P.L.L.C., by: Donald H. Henry, Lance R. Miller, John K. Baker, and Derrick W. Smith, Little Rock, for appellant.

David M. Hargis, Little Rock, for appellees.


JOSEPHINE LINKER HART, Judge.

This appeal arises from a lawsuit filed by appellees George Mackey and Jones & Mackey Construction Co., LLC, against appellant Superior Federal Bank for breach of contract, promissory estoppel, intentional interference with contractual relations, defamation, and punitive damages.
